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Expansion: Larger expansions typically require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Type of Landscaping: The choice between basic grass, elaborate gardens, or hardscaping will significantly affect the budget.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and zoning laws may require additional fees and time.
- Soil Quality: Poor soil may need treatment or replacement, adding to the expense.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-access areas may require special equipment, increasing labor costs.
- Materials Used: High-end materials for decking, fencing, or paving will elevate costs compared to basic options.
- Labor Costs: Hourly rates for skilled labor can vary, affecting the total cost.
- Utilities Installation: Adding water, electricity, or gas lines will increase the expense.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Grove City, OH) |
---|---|
Basic Landscaping |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Installing a Patio |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Building a Deck | $4,000 - $10,000 |
Adding a Swimming Pool | $20,000 - $50,000 |
Fencing Installation |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Outdoor Lighting Installation | $500 - $2,000 |
Garden Bed Installation | $500 - $2,000 |
Soil Treatment | $500 - $1,500 |
